Monday, February 9, 2009 Missouri plays Kansas at home Monday. Oklahoma comes to Columbia on March 4. Why shouldn't Mizzou coach Mike Anderson believe the Tigers can win the Big 12? Well, he does. Monday night's contest is the first of two games between the heated rivals. Kansas (8-0) is ahead of Missouri (7-2) by two games in the conference loss column. So, too, is Oklahoma (9-0).
